Lilith, a Vampire who Comes BackI (2008)

gothic fever dreamvintage Euro-horrorlow-budget chaos

Overview

Horror

Lusilla Helm has to marry Baron Ludwig Von Reder against her will. But her honeymoon does not last very long. The poor girl dies and is buried inside the family tomb. After a short while, another woman announces herself at the doors of the baron's mansion. Her looks recall Lusilla's but in a disturbing way. As soon as the mysterious woman sets foot in the rooms where the baron's former wife used to live, strange noises and happenings start to haunt the silent halls of the house.

Trivia

Shot in Sicily with a reported budget under €10,000, making its visual coherence something of a minor miracle.

Cultural

The title's 'I' suggests planned sequels that never materialized—this Lilith's cinematic reign was cut short.
